Program Overview

This training aims to educate professionals for the Civil Engineering, Building and Public Works sector in general, and more specifically, for companies, design offices, and expert firms.

Furthermore, we are witnessing the emergence of a promising field in terms of employability and research, which is experiencing rapid technological evolution, namely the development of new materials. These materials require the introduction of new technologies, new execution methods, and new commercial techniques, and consequently, a resurgence in the demand for specialized personnel.

Teaching Language : French

Professional opportunities at the management level are significant in all phases of a construction operation:

  • Work scheduling: Public sector (local authorities, construction companies).
  • Structural calculations: Design offices, engineering firms.
  • Work management and monitoring, and quality control of structures: General contracting and secondary works construction companies, control offices.
  • Maintenance and asset management: Technical management, rehabilitation, planning.
  • Site monitoring: Medium and large-scale Civil Engineering Building and Public Works (B.T.P) projects.
